Product Details

This replacement U-Joint for Chevrolet K1500 is designed for a precise fit on Chevrolet and GMC K1500/K2500 4WD trucks from model years 1988–1998 with various engine configurations. It serves as a critical component connecting the rear driveshaft to the differential or the front driveshaft to the transfer case, restoring smooth power transmission.

It directly replaces common aftermarket parts, including MOOG 355, MOOG 235 (Super Strength), Spicer 5-213X, and SVL 15-213X.

Installation Notes

  1. Safely raise and secure the vehicle on jack stands.
  2. Mark the driveshaft's orientation relative to the differential yoke for re-installation.
  3. Unbolt the driveshaft straps from the differential yoke and carefully lower the driveshaft.
  4. Remove the external or internal retaining clips from the old U-joint.
  5. Using a U-joint press, bench vise, or hammer and socket, press the old joint out of the driveshaft yoke.
  6. Thoroughly clean the yoke bores.
  7. Remove the caps from the new U-joint and carefully insert it into the driveshaft yokes.
  8. Press the new caps into place, ensuring no needle bearings are displaced.
  9. Install the new retaining clips.
  10. Re-install the driveshaft, aligning the marks, and torque the strap bolts to manufacturer specifications.

Troubleshooting & FAQ

How do I know if my U-joint is failing?

Common signs of a bad U-joint include a clunking noise when shifting into drive or reverse, vibrations felt through the floor of the vehicle that increase with speed, or a squeaking sound that corresponds with driveshaft rotation.

Do I need special tools for installation?

Yes, proper installation requires a press-fit. A U-joint press, a heavy-duty bench vise, or specialized C-clamp tools are highly recommended to press the old joint out and the new one in without damaging the driveshaft yokes or the new bearing caps.

Is this a greasable or non-greasable part?

This part may be available in both greasable (serviceable) and non-greasable (sealed-for-life) versions, which are generally stronger. The specific type is noted in the product details. If greasable, it will require periodic lubrication.

Does this fit both front and rear driveshafts?

On compatible models, this U-joint is listed for use at the rear driveshaft (at the differential) and the front driveshaft (at the transfer case). However, positions can vary by model, so always confirm the part needed for your specific location.
